Output 3689b1ca2140ea98b95e6b9adf31a75d8f458fb500ba9907cd49d2877b71670f:1

value
1013096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ccf2ca2b2ab8bd5eb262935f8e9c782de07b037b OP_EQUAL
address
3LNgd17RV3dqGadMGm1x41LaAW69Ssoscz
transaction
3689b1ca2140ea98b95e6b9adf31a75d8f458fb500ba9907cd49d2877b71670f
confirmations
68454
spent
true